Toyota's Engineering, Excellence, and Strategy (EES) Pack, Assembly, Controls, Caseweld, and Chassis (PACCC) Department seeks a passionate and highly-motivated Battery Pack Assembly Engineer.
The primary responsibility of this role is to lead and manage new model projects from all aspects of PACCC engineering in Toyota's North American Manufacturing Shops.
Reporting to the Manager, the person in this role will support the PACCC Engineering department's objective to provide new model processes to the manufacturing facilities which meet all targets for Safety, Quality, Productivity and Cost.
